Manage the smaller content lists
Audience: operators · Scope: the short admin lists that feed icons, tags and small page sections · Last reviewed: 2026-07-20
What this does — Beyond the big content screens (homepage, news, projects, designers) the menu holds a row of short lists. Each one feeds a small, specific part of the site: an icon strip, a dropdown, a carousel. They're all ordinary list screens, so once you know one you know them all — this article says what each one actually feeds, so you can find the right screen quickly.

What each list feeds
| Menu entry | What it feeds |
|---|---|
| Industries | The Industry classification on project showcases, and the industry filter on the public Projects gallery |
| Industry Icons | The small icon strip on a product page and on its spec sheet PDF (assigned per product) |
| Approvals | The certification/approval logos on a product page and its spec sheet PDF (assigned per product) |
| Diagrams | The dimensional drawings on a product page, the Dimensional Diagrams PDF, and the spec sheet PDF |
| Contact Cards | The digital business-card pages at /contact-cards/<name> |
| Social Media | The social icon strip in the site header and footer |
| Testimonials | The testimonial carousel that can be placed on any page |
| Innovations | A tagging list on products — it isn't rendered on the public site today |
| Specifier Types | A classification list that isn't used on the public site today |
| About us | The About Us page — its text, photo, and the team members slider |
Icon lists — Industry Icons, Approvals, Mountings
These three work identically: each entry is a Title plus an image, and products are linked to them on the product edit screen (the Industry Icons, Approval Images and Mounting Icons fields).
- Click the list in the menu, then Add.
- Enter the Title and upload the image.
- Set the Ordering and click Save.
- Open the products that should show it and tick it in the matching field.
Upload high-resolution images. These are printed into the spec sheet PDF, not just shown on screen — the guidance on the screen itself is that about 1000px of height fills roughly a quarter of the PDF page.
Diagrams (dimensional drawings)
Diagrams are per-product technical drawings.
- Click Diagrams, then Add.
- Fill in the Internal Name (required — this is what you'll search for in the admin), an optional Title shown to customers, upload the Diagram Image, and pick the Product it belongs to.
- Optionally restrict it with Allowed Customer Groups, set Active, and Save.
Unlike the icon lists, a diagram points at one product from its own screen — you don't assign it from the product side.
Contact Cards
Each card is a shareable digital business card with its own web address, e.g.
/contact-cards/jane-smith.
- Click Contact Cards, then Add.
- Fill in the SEF Segment (required — the end of the web address), First Name, Last Name (required), and upload the Image.
- Add whatever the person wants shown: Middle Names, Position, Company, Tag Line, Email, Phone, Location, URL Google Maps (turns the location into a map link), URL LinkedIn, and URL Website.
- Click Save — the edit screen shows the live link to the finished card.
Social Media
The icon strip linking to Beta-Calco's social accounts, shown in the site header and footer.
- Click Social Media, then Add.
- Fill in the Social Media name (required — YouTube, LinkedIn, …) and the Social Media Account URL
(required — the full address, including
https://). - Upload both the Image and the Hover Image — the second is what shows when someone points at the icon, so the pair should match in size.
- Set the Ordering and Active, then Save.

Testimonials
The quote carousel that Beta-Calco drops onto marketing pages.
- Click Testimonials, then Add.
- Fill in the Internal Name (required, admin-only), upload the Logo Image of the customer's company, write the Quote, and add the person's Name and Position.
- Upload the Portrait Image, optionally add a URL to social profile (this turns the portrait and name into a link), set the Ordering, and Save.
There are two Testimonials screens. This one is the marketing carousel. The other lives under Career Page → Testimonials and holds employee quotes for the careers page — see Update the career page.
About us
About us is a single record, so the menu entry opens the edit form directly — there's no list.
- Click About us.
- Edit the Description (the page text — required) and the Photo.
- Below that, Team Members is a small grid: each person has a Photo, Name, Role, an optional Department, and an Ordering. Add, edit or reorder them here.
- Click Save.
What happens next
- Changes are live on the next page load — there's no publish step beyond the Active switch where a screen has one.
- Icons and diagrams that feed the spec sheet PDF only reach it when that PDF is regenerated; use Refresh cached specsheet PDF on the product if you need it right away.
Good to know
- An entry with nothing assigned does nothing. Icons, approvals and industries only appear once a product or showcase is linked to them.
- Innovations and Specifier Types don't currently show anywhere on the public site. Keep them tidy if you like, but don't spend time on them expecting a visible result — check with your Beta-Calco contact before building anything on them.
- Internal Name vs Title. Several of these screens have both: the Internal Name is for you (it's what the admin list shows and searches), the Title is what customers read.
- Deleting removes it everywhere. A deleted icon disappears from every product that used it. Deactivate or rename instead when you're unsure.
